Made In’s chef-loved knives and pans are on sale

The aesthetic cookware market is increasingly crowded, but Made In’s high-quality cookware has earned its chops; the company was actually started by a fourth-generation, family-owned kitchen supply business in Boston, and is used by thousands of restaurants (many, Michelin-starred) across the country. Fishwife’s fancy tinned delicacies are 20% off

Fishwife’s a staff fave at Eater; its tinned sardines with hot pepper have become my recurring pantry splurge, and one that can really save me when I’m blanking on what to make for lunch or dinner. I’ll pop open a tin over leafy greens and onions, and enjoy with some crusty bread for a refreshing, high-protein meal. The company also sources its tinned delights from healthy fisheries and certified sustainable aquaculture farms, hence, the slightly loftier price tag than some other grocery-store brands, but it just launched a 20 percent off (nearly everything) promotion with the code SUMMERSALE at check out.
